About the book
This textbook will help students understand the contemporary challenges facing hotel and lodging operations and develop the resiliency and skillsets needed to apprach working in a dynamic global industry.
Hotel Operations Management provides a comprehensive foundation in the principles and practices shaping today's hotel and hospitality sector. Designed for undergraduate and postgraduate hospitality and tourism management students, this textbook bridges academic learning with the realities of managing hotels in a fast-changing world.
Reflecting the recent transformations in global hospitality, it examines how digital innovation, sustainability and evolving guest expectations have redefined operational excellence. Students will gain insight into how hotels implement health and safety protocols, integrate AI and big data for enhanced guest experience and adopt eco-practices to drive long-term sustainability.
This textbook includes:
- Frameworks for crisis response, digital transformation and sustainable operations
- Real-world examples from Hilton Hotels, Taj Hotels and the American Hotel & Lodging Association (AHLA), illustrating contemporary hotel management challenges
- Hypothetical examples based on industry insights to apply theory into practice
- Reflective questions to reinforce critical thinking and practical application
- Additional online resources of lecturer slides, an instructor's manual and student exercises
Whether preparing for a career in hospitality or advancing your expertise in hotel operations, Hotel Operations Management equips students with the knowledge, confidence and critical insight to lead in today's competitive hospitality landscape.

Table of contents
- Chapter - 01: Introduction – the new hospitality landscape;
- Chapter - 02: Adaptive strategies;
- Chapter - 03: Crisis management and resilience;
- Chapter - 04: Digital transformation in hospitality;
- Chapter - 05: The evolution of guest experiences;
- Chapter - 06: Sustainability and innovation in hotel operations;
- Chapter - 07: Contemporary and future-focused human resources strategies;
- Chapter - 08: Marketing and brand management in the new era;
- Chapter - 09: Financial management and accounting – navigating crisis, embracing change;
- Chapter - 10: Legal and ethical issues in hotel operations;
- Chapter - 11: Future of hotel operations;
